The recent victory of democratic socialist Zohran Mamdani in New York City's mayoral race has ignited a significant conversation about the future of capitalism in the United States. Mamdani's win is seen as a reflection of the increasing popularity of socialist ideals, particularly in urban centers where economic inequality remains a pressing issue. Supporters argue that his policies, which advocate for affordable housing, healthcare access, and workers' rights, resonate with a populace disillusioned by traditional capitalist frameworks.
Critics, however, warn that the rise of socialism could undermine the very foundations of American prosperity. They argue that increased government intervention in the economy may stifle innovation and entrepreneurship, essential components of a thriving capitalist society. As Mamdani prepares to take office, the implications of his victory are being closely monitored, with many questioning whether this trend towards socialism could reshape the political landscape and economic policies across the nation.
The debate over the balance between capitalism and socialism is intensifying, as more voters begin to embrace alternative economic models that prioritize social equity. The future of American economic policy may hinge on how well these contrasting ideologies can coexist in an increasingly polarized political environment.
